点击关闭
 

[放大封面]   [放大封底]
 
 
【相关下载】
【二手书】
本产品共有 0 册二手书出售,
最低价:¥.00 [查看]
 
 推荐图书
软件工程:实践者的研究方...
作者:(美)Roger S.Pressman
UML面向对象分析与建模
作者:唐学忠
编程匠艺:编写卓越的代码
作者:古德理弗
实用Java语言单元式模块化...
作者:任泰明
软件需求工程
作者:毋国庆
软件工程基础
作者:李国彬
 
 用户购买本书还购买了
· 小言皇帝内经与生命科学
· 测试驱动开发
· 编程之美 微软技术面试心得
· JAVA 数据结构和算法(第二版)
 
 金书共建·What's this? 
[分类共建]    ·所有未分类图书查看
本书当前分类:

软件工程及软件方法学 > 综合
我觉得本书应分到此类中:

[金书WIKI]
[ 编辑 ]当前页面使本书内容更加完善
[资源共建]
·提交本书书摘 ·提交本书相关资源

重构——改善既有代码的设计(影印版)
您想读这本书吗?
原书名:Refactoring: Improving the Design of Existing Code 原出版社:
作者: Martin Fowler 出版社: 中国电力出版社
译者:   丛书名: 软件工程系列
出版日期:2003-5-1 上架日期:2005-10-8
ISBN:7508315014 页数:      版次:1-1
开本:16开 装帧:

市场价:¥49.00

贵宾会员价:¥34.91
高级会员价:¥36.75
普通会员价:¥36.75
金书豆豆(What's this?)
种一个豆豆,书价我来定
我要种一个豆豆
【您的购物车】
购买册数:     
货到付款:北京、上海、天津、广州、深圳、湖北、河南、山西、陕西、山东、四川、重庆、浙江 更多查看>>

| 大封面 | 封底 | 前言 | 内容简介 | 序言 | 目录 | 作者简介 | 译者简介 | 作者序 | 译者序 |

【读者评论】

内容简介

软件工程领域的超级经典巨著,与另一巨著《设计模式》并称"软工双雄",全美销量超过100000册,亚马逊书店五星书。



第一作者martin fowler,除了是对象技术方面的专家外,还是uml和模式方面的专家。他撰写的analysis
patterns、uml distilled、patterns of enterprise application architecture和planning
extreme programming几本书也广受赞誉,在亚马逊上的评价也极高(最低星级为4星),从这些也足可见其在业内的显赫地位。相信这本书以影印版的形式在国内推出,巨匠巨著,原汁原味,无疑是给国内广大软件开发人员提供了一盏前进路上的明灯。



在本书中,作者martin fowler充分展示了何处可能需要重构,以及如何将不好的设计改造为良好的设计。 本书除了讨论重构的各种技巧之外,还提供了超过70个可行重构的详细目录,给出了重构的工作原理,并以step
by step的形式给出了应用每一种重构的指南。这些示例都是用java语言写成的,但其中的思想却可以运用到任何面对象的编程语言中。


《重构(中文版)》——侯捷2003年最新译作


中文版1-3样章试读   
中文版译者与您在线讨论




目录
伸缩显示:尺寸伸长 尺寸缩减 [弹出查看]

伸缩显示:尺寸伸长
尺寸缩减 [弹出查看]

编辑荐语

[您可以向编辑推荐本书的亮点,采纳后奖励5-10元优惠卷](一个工作日内处理您的建议)

本书除了讨论重构的各种技巧之外,还提供了超过70个可行重构的详细编目,对如何应用它们给出了有用的提示;并以step by step的形式给出了应用每一种重构的指南;而且用实例展示了重构的工作原理。这些示例都是用Java语言写成的,但其中的思想却可以运用于任何面向对象编程语言。




读者评论 w 查看本书所有书评 

[发表您的书评,编辑将根据书评质量,予以相应的奖励]

 读者:dodoshow  最新讨论:2008-2-13 11:41:37  评价等级:   
一口气读完这本书,感觉书中作者对于程序的风格、设计要求几乎已经到了偏执的程度,他对代码的整理不像是一种技术,更像是一种艺术,那种对代码的审视角度更多地像是从一种工程美学去看,拒绝任何一点瑕疵、缺憾、笨拙、丑陋、bad smell,要求百分百的优雅、精致、完美。这不正像一个艺术家对自己作品至善至美的要求吗?而且他所列出的技术上的bad smell恰恰也是我平时看上去感觉别扭、丑陋、笨拙的地方,这种工程与美学、技术与技术的相通,也许就是事物同一性的一种体现吧?
  支持   反对   查看讨论[0]

 读者:zh_sherry  最新讨论:2006-7-27 9:11:59  评价等级:   
  很不错的一本java书。      书本并没有讲很高深的理论,而是用初学者都能看懂的例子告诉你各种不同的实现方式(类结构)有什么不同的优点缺点,从而让你明白在实际编程过程中如何优化你的代码。      另外,如果你是一个从c语言等面向过程的编程语言转型而来,这本书的内容能够帮你更好的理解和接受以及实施真正的“面向对象”的编程思想。  
  支持   反对   查看讨论[0]

(共2条)


百度搜索本站: